Crisis communications involves developing and executing messaging strategies during urgent situations that threaten an organization's reputation, operations, or stakeholder trust. Practitioners prepare response plans, coordinate internal and external messaging across channels, and manage media relations while maintaining transparency and controlling narrative during high-pressure events. Organizations use this skill to minimize reputational damage, maintain stakeholder confidence, and guide teams through incidents ranging from product failures to leadership scandals to operational emergencies.
